Hideyuki Ohashi ( Japanese: 大橋 秀 行 O: hashi Hideyuki , born March 8, 1965 , Yokohama ) is a Japanese professional boxer who performs in the minimum weight category. He is the world champion in versions of WBA and WBC .

In February 1990, he won the WBA world title in minimum weight, knocking out Korean Choi Chom Hwang . After completing his sports career, he proved himself as a boxing coach.
